10 Hartsbourne Drive is a 84 m² / 904 sq ft detached home in Bournemouth. It sold for £337,500 in November 2016.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£445k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£329k to £438k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 4 August 2026.

-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£444,647.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Bournemouth are now selling for between £3,920 and £5,210 per square metre (£364 and £484 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 84 m², this implies a valuation between £329,000 and £438,000. Treat this as context only.
